Two balls, A and B, are projected simultaneously from two points on the same level horizontal ground. Ball A is projected with speed u₁ at an angle θ₁ with the horizontal, and Ball B is projected towards A with speed u₂ at an angle θ₂ with the horizontal. For the balls to collide in mid-air, which of the following conditions must be satisfied?
A
u₁cosθ₁ = u₂cosθ₂
B
u₁sinθ₁ = u₂sinθ₂
C
u₁ = u₂
D
u₁sinθ₂ = u₂sinθ₁
